MI SJRB | 2023-2024 | 102nd Legislature

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 1-0)
Status: Introduced on February 16 2023 - 25% progression
Action: 2023-02-16 - Referred To Committee On Government Operations
Pending: Senate Government Operations Committee
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[HTML]

Summary

Legislature: rules; bills or initiative petitions to take effect upon the expiration of 90 days after the date they are filed with the secretary of state; provide for. Amends sec. 27, art. IV of the state constitution.
